West Indies Women defeated Pakistan by 146 runs in the first One-Day International of the three-match ICC Championship series at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ium on Thursday, February 7.

The Windies women racked up 216 for five off 50 overs with Deandra Dottin putting up 96, Stafanie Taylor recorded her half-century with 58 runs and Shemaine Campbelle posting 26 not out.

Pakistan women made 70 off 29.5 overs, Nahida Khan scoring 23, Javeria Khan 21 with Deandra Dottin taking 3-14 and Afy Fletcher recording 3-17.
